Title: Data Engineer: Empowering Insights and Driving Data-Driven Success Introduction: Welcome to our blog post where we explore the exciting and rapidly evolving role of a Data Engineer in today's data-driven world. As organizations continue to harness the power of data,the need for skilled professionals who can collect,organize,and analyze vast amounts of information becomes increasingly vital. In this article,we'll dive into the responsibilities,skills,and opportunities that define the role of a Data Engineer and shed light on how they contribute to unlocking valuable insights and driving business success. Section 1: What is a Data Engineer? In this section,we'll define the role of a Data Engineer and explore their primary responsibilities. We'll discuss how Data Engineers work closely with other stakeholders,such as Data Scientists and Analysts,to design and implement scalable data infrastructure solutions. We'll also highlight the role's impact on ensuring data quality,availability,and security. Section 2: Key Responsibilities of a Data Engineer Here,we'll delve into the core responsibilities of a Data Engineer. We'll discuss data ingestion,transformation,and integration processes,highlighting the crucial role Data Engineers play in designing and maintaining robust ETL (Extract,Transform,Load) pipelines. We'll explore their involvement in data modeling,schema design,and database management to ensure efficient data storage and retrieval. Section 3: Skills and Tools for Data Engineering In this section,we'll outline the essential skills and tools that Data Engineers employ to excel in their roles. We'll discuss programming languages like Python,SQL,and Scala,and explore how proficiency in data processing frameworks like Apache Spark and Hadoop can greatly enhance a Data Engineer's capabilities. We'll also touch on their familiarity with cloud platforms such as AWS,GCP,or Azure and highlight the importance of data warehousing technologies like Redshift,BigQuery,or Snowflake. Section 4: Data Engineering Best Practices Here,we'll share some industry best practices for Data Engineers. We'll cover topics like data pipeline monitoring,error handling,and data quality assurance. We'll also explore the concept of data governance and its significance in ensuring regulatory compliance,data privacy,and ethical data usage. Section 5: Career Paths and Opportunities In the final section,we'll discuss the various career paths available to Data Engineers. We'll shed light on how their expertise and experience can lead to roles such as Data Architect,Data Science Engineer,or Machine Learning Engineer. We'll also discuss the growing demand for Data Engineers across different industries and how they can stay up-to-date with the latest trends and technologies. Conclusion: Data Engineers form the backbone of any data-driven organization,enabling the collection,integration,and analysis of vast amounts of data. Their skills and expertise empower businesses to make informed decisions,gain competitive advantages,and unlock valuable insights. We hope this blog post has provided you with a comprehensive understanding of the role of a Data Engineer and its significance in today's data-centric world. Whether you're considering a career in data engineering or seeking to collaborate with these professionals,their contributions are invaluable in driving data-driven success.
